Featured dishes

View full menu
Margherita
Mozzarella, tomato and fresh basil
Siciliana
Cured ham, artichokes, olives, anchovy, garlic, mozzarella & tomato
Americana
Pepperoni sausage, mozzarella and tomato. (With hot green pepper £9.65)
Florentina
Fresh spinach, free range egg, olives, garlic, parmesan, mozzarella and tomato
Marinara
King prawns, anchovies, capers, olives, red onions and tomato (no cheese)

So yesterday me and my Wife headed out for lunch and we randomly decided to try Croma as we had never been before but we have long known about the great reputation that Croma has. So we arrived and parked for free on the small car park in front of the restaurant, We walked into the restaurant and we were warmly greeted by a waitress who took is to a table, we hadn't booked but luckily the restaurant was busy but plenty of tables were available. After a few minutes the waitress returned and took our drink orders I ordered a large bottle of Peroni(Italian Lager) as they don't have any beers on draught and my Wife opted for a glass of red wine, Drinks came and were well served and went down a treat. A few minutes later the waitress came back to take our food order, To start my Wife ordered king prawns and I opted for bruschetta and for mains i opted for bolognese ragu and my wine opted for chicken pasta dish and to share we ordered a Garlic Cheese bread to share. My Wife really, really enjoyed her king prawns and my bruschetta was amazing so fresh and fragrant and the chopped Tomatos with the the onion and garlic were the perfect combination. Several minutes later our table had been cleared and our Mains arrived again food was hot, well presented and tasted absolutely delicious, My Wife really enjoyed her Chicken pasta dish and my Bolognese ragu was great the flavours went together so well, Generous portion and the cheesy garlic bread was amazing, Cooked to perfection. We ordered another glass of red wine 🍷 and I ordered another large bottle of Peroni, We then had a Double Baileys over ice 🧊 each and settled our bill, Food and drink came to £99 and we gave a £15 tip. Absolutely beautiful lunch at Croma today! Stumbled across this place when looking for somewhere to eat and we are so glad we did 👏🏼 Lots of affordable dishes with a great lunchtime deal! I can't even begin to explain how amazing the food was, I had the Parmesan wedges (with a garlic mayo and chilli jam) and the lasagne which was absolutely incredible!!! My partner had the pizza which he also said was super tasty 🤤 We were also given ice water for the table free of charge! The only thing I would like to mention is that it would be great if the ceramic lasagne dish came with a protective outer dish, I've been to some other places where they use a silicone sleeve which would be great. I did burn two of my fingers on the dish as it was scolding hot and straight out of the oven - the staff did warn me that the dish was hot and it was definitely my own fault but I'd hate for this to happen to anyone else or children, as it's a very easy mistake to make and one of the staff mentioned they were once burned 🙁 Again, not a fault of the restaurant or staff at all, but definitely something that could be improved to prevent future injury. Overall we will definitely be back soon and we'd 100% recommend Croma xx

Vegan review: Booked this table at the last minute with friends! The vegan options were not clearly marked, however the staff were happy to go through the menu and discuss them. They said it is something they’re looking to improve. I got garlic bread with vegan cheese - the garlic came in a separate pot as their original garlic butter has dairy in it. It was so delicious! Then got the goat’s cheese and roasted red onion salad for main, swapping in vegan cheese. The salad bit was a bit bland but the cheese, tomatoes and onion on French bread was delightful! I think they forgot the pine nuts. For dessert, the only option was lemon sorbet, so had that. They told me they used to do another dessert, ‘cheese’ cake I believe. To drink, I had a couple of elderflower pressés. The service was great, the food was lovely, prices were reasonable, the location was central! I would give more stars for clearly marked vegan options and more of them.

Me and my son had lunch at Croma today and been very very disappointed. The starter (garlic bread with tomato) came really cold, we are sure that the chef forgot to add the tomato sauce and garlic at the beginning as the sauce was really cold and the garlic butter still solid on the top and the potato wedges were cold too. For the main one of us had the Nicoise salad , when ordering we were told they had no Tuna today, my son agreed on having haddock instead. Then they came back and told us they had no boild egg ( an egg can be boild in less than 5 minutes), again my son didn't mind, at the end the salad was served with three ingredients missing ( they didn't even add the dough balls too, which was part of the salad) as it's not in my son's nature to be fussy he didn't mention it while he was eating. When finished he said that" my salad didn't have the dough ball either " I mentioned it to two of the staff one of which I believe was the manager, to our surprise he started lecturing us with unreasonable excuses. No matter how much we tried to explain that what they served was neither a Nicoise salae nor a Haddock salad , as most of the ingredients were missing. The service was really bad and all he could tell us that we will be charged for Haddock salad (£10.25) and not £10.50 the price of Nicoise salad !!!!!!! Whereas in fact what they needed to do was to accept that they made a mistake and apologies. We will never go back to this place again which is a shame as it used to be our favourite restaurant...
